@Shion Check out the NWOBHM (New Wave of British Heavy Metal). It was a huge movement of British heavy metal bands, there's enough for a rookie metalhead to get used to metal before diving into thrash, and eventually extreme metal. Iron Maiden lead this movement. I also recommend Saxon, Tank, Diamond Head, Angel Witch, Candlemass, and Satan as sort of a "heavy metal starterpack", since those are historically influential to future metal bands. I highly recommend Dio's Holy Diver and Cynic's Traced in Air as well, those two are among my all-time favorites. Traced in Air will introduce you to progressive metal/jazz fusion, it's awesome. \m/
